Leading Sql Interview Questions As Well As Solutions

It offers its own question language (Hibernate Question Language/ HQL) that completes where SQL falls short when handling objects. Prospects are virtually assured to be asked a collection of concerns associated with a acquiring information from a provided set of tables.
It is a collection of schemas, tables, procedures, code functions, and also various other objects. Various question languages are made use of to access and control information. In SQL Server, a table is an things that stores data in a tabular form. Right here is a listing of one of the most popular SQL Server interview inquiries and also their answers with comprehensive descriptions and SQL question instances. MERGE statement is utilized to integrate insert, erase and also upgrade operations into one statement.
A Trigger is a Data source things similar to a kept procedure or we can state it is a special kind of Stored Treatment which terminates when an event occurs in a database. It is a data source things that is bound to a table and is performed immediately. Triggers offer information stability and also utilized to accessibility as well as check data before and also after adjustment using DDL or DML query. Normalization is the process of organizing data right into a related table. It also removes redundancy as well as raises stability which improves the performance of the inquiry. To normalize a database, we split the database into tables and also establish connections between the tables. Multiple columns can participate in the main key.
The main secret is the column or set of columns utilized to distinctly identify the products in a table. A international secret is used to uniquely recognize the products in a different table, permitting join operations to take place. An Index is an optional structure pertaining to a table. It is utilized to access rows directly as well as can be created to boost the performance of information access. The index can be developed on one or more columns of a table. DML enables you to work with the information that goes into the database.
It is likewise made use of to synchronize two tables and make the modifications in one table based upon values matched from one more. SQL provision is utilized to filter some rows from the whole collection of documents with the help of various conditional declarations.
A model is a container for all items that define the framework of the master data. A model contains at the very least one entity, which is similar to a table in a relational data source. An entity includes participants, which are like the rows in a table, as displayed in Number 7-1. Members are the master information that you are handling in MDS. Each fallen leave member of the entity has several characteristics, which correspond to table columns in the example. Now to create 3 tables in the Master database called Table1, Table2, and also Table3. Information Control Language commands manipulate information stored in things like tables, views and so on.
Or else, all records in the table will certainly be updated. However you can't start up until the required sample information is not in position.
The one-of-a-kind key is the group of several fields or columns that uniquely determines the data source record. The unique secret coincides as a primary crucial however it approves the void value. Although it isn't clearly necessary to understand the internal functions of data sources, it assists to have a high level understanding of basic concepts in Data sources and also Equipments. Data sources refers not to particular ones but much more so how they operate at a high level and also what layout choices as well as trade-offs are made during building as well as quizing. "Systems" is a wide term but describes any collection of structures or devices by which analysis of huge volumes of information depends on.
You can look into the tables below that we've attended to practice. So to start with, you require to produce the test information in your data source software.
Yet the response to such concerns from SQL meetings ought to be much more detailed. Make clear later UPDATEwhich documents must be updated.
For instance, a common meeting topic is the MapReduce structure which is greatly used at numerous companies for parallel processing of big datasets. The CREATE TABLE statement is made use of to create a brand-new table in a database. It is an essential command when producing brand-new database. A normalized data source is normally composed of several tables. Joins are, for that reason, required to query throughout several tables. The UPDATE statement is used to change the existing records in a table and is among one of the most used procedures for dealing with the database. Hibernate is an object-relational mapping library that takes Java things as well as maps them right into relational data source tables.
So, an SQL sign up with is a device that enables you to create a partnership between things in your database. As a result, a join shows a result collection having areas stemmed from two or more tables. SQL is an acronym for Structured Query Language. It is a programming language specifically created for working with databases. An inner sign up with is when you incorporate rows from two tables and also develop a result set based upon the predicate, or joining problem. The internal join just returns rows when it locates a suit in both tables. An outer sign up with will also return unparalleled rows from one table if it is a single external sign up with, or both tables if it is a full outer sign up with.
With the help of these commands, you can quickly modify, insert and erase your data. Making use of these commands, you can develop any objects like tables, views, databases, sets off, and so forth. An index is a data source object that is produced as well as kept by the DBMS. Indexed columns are gotten or arranged to make sure that information browsing is extremely rapid. An index can be put on a column or a view.
The clustered index specifies the order in which data is physically stored in a database table and used for very easy access by modifying the way that the documents are stored. As the name indicates, join is the name of combining columns from one or a number of tables by utilizing typical worths to every. Whenever the signs up with are made use of, the tricks play a important function.
DML is used to insert, choose, upgrade, and also remove records in the database. The operator is UPDATEused to customize existing records.
The MERGE declaration permits conditional update or insertion of data into a data source table. It carries out an UPDATE if the rows exists, or an INSERT if the row does not exist.
You can try putting worths to break these conditions and also see what occurs. Multiple columns can join the main crucial column. After that the originality is thought about among all the participant columns by incorporating their worths. The majority of tasks in MDS focus on designs and the objects they consist of.
A solid example of this will plainly highlight the distinction and demonstrate how well the developer understands joins. With more companies depending on big information analytics than ever, staff members with solid SQL abilities are extremely sought after. SQL is used in many different tasks such as business analysts, software application engineer, systems administrators, data researchers, and much more. Now, this column does not enable null values and duplicate values.